    Are you sure there's no hole for the ground wire?

    The kit should come pre-drilled with a hole to the control rout, positioned under where the bridge will go (highlighted in red). It's at an angle, so can look more like a mark than a hole.

    If there isn't one, then you'll need to drill one, and you'll need a very long drill bit to do that. Look for a 300mm long bit. Partly because its a long hole and partly so the drill doesn't get in the way and you can get the angle correct I'd suggest a 4mm bit. It won't t be easy to get the angle right. You'll need to drill from the top to the rout, you won't be able to drill the other way. It may be cheapest to buy a set, something like this. https://www.amazon.co.uk/300mm-Extra...NsaWNrPXRydWU=

    Drill a small depth vertical hole first, otherwise you'll never get the drill bit to bite and not skid over the surface. I'd also suggest cutting out a wedge of the correct drilling angle from scrap wood that you can lay the drill on top of after securing it in place with double sided tape, and use pencil lines to get the direction right.
